*East Meets West in this pioneer Western~ Rafe McKuen, the son of an Osage chief's daughter and a successful American fur trader turned planter, has one foot in each world. As a child, he often visited his mother's tribal camp near St. Louis. At his father's Louisiana plantation, he was a beloved son, but "invisible" to New Orleans society which ignores his existence. Now he is a man---where will he spend his life--in which world? Miss Eve Holcombe is an Eastern beauty with influential relatives. Her father's unexpected announcement that they are moving West startles and worries Eve. Why, she asks. But her father has a secret and a plan he won't reveal. He insists she trust him. And if she stays in the East, her ambitious aunt will try to marry her off to her aunt's advantage. Both Rafe and Eve are on a journey, a Journey to Respect. But such journeys are rarely uncomplicated or without dangers. And falling in love is the most dangerous of all.
